Output 31a6b664da543f0a7ebc28c7797a8836c1059c0f36455cd74632996f1c927c28:14

value
49950000
script pubkey
OP_0 OP_PUSHBYTES_20 601f92d5ef0675e62755b7c6e9bffcfae22070fc
address
bc1qvq0e9400qe67vf64klrwn0lult3zqu8udumpmx
transaction
31a6b664da543f0a7ebc28c7797a8836c1059c0f36455cd74632996f1c927c28
confirmations
210538
spent
true